This is a fascinating book that exposes the dangers of America's diet. The authors, Joanna Samorow-Merzer, Howard F. Lyman, and Glen Merzer, offer a compelling critique of the American food industry. Published by Scribner in 2005, this trade paperback has 288 pages and is written in English. The book measures 8.5 inches in length, 5.5 inches in width, and 0.9 inches in height.
